Symptoms

  • •Dashboard warning lights illuminated
  • •Power windows malfunctioning or inoperative
  • •Headlights or taillights flickering or failing
  • •Difficulty starting the engine
  • •Radio or infotainment system not functioning
  • •Electrical accessories not working properly

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the negative terminal of the battery to ensure safety during electrical work.
2. Battery Inspection and Testing
  • Remove the battery terminals (negative first, then positive).
  • Clean any corrosion using a wire brush and baking soda solution.
  • Test the battery with a multimeter; if below 12.4 volts, consider replacing it.
  • Reconnect the battery terminals.
3. Fuse Inspection
  • Locate the fuse box (typically under the dashboard or in the engine compartment).
  • Use the fuse puller tool to remove and inspect each fuse.
  • Replace any blown fuses with the correct amperage rating.
4. Wiring Inspection
  • Visually inspect wiring harnesses for frayed wires or damaged insulation.
  • Repair or replace any damaged wiring using heat-shrink tubing for protection.
5. Alternator Testing
  • Start the engine and connect the multimeter to the battery terminals.
  • Confirm the voltage output is between 13.8 and 14.4 volts; if not, consider replacing the alternator.
6. Parasitic Draw Testing
  • With the vehicle off, connect an ammeter in series with the battery negative terminal.
  • Measure the current draw; it should be below 50 mA. If higher, systematically remove fuses to identify the circuit causing the draw.
